Role Overview The primary role of the Commercial Training Manager is to train, equip, and certify the sales force on Smith & Nephew's products, relevant procedural knowledge, surgical / treatment pathways, and necessary selling and planning skills to exceed sales quota and revenue targets. This is a highly skilled role requiring subject matter expertise on Smith & Nephew's portfolio, value propositions, competitive market, clinical acumen, selling skills, and business acumen. Their goal is to equip the commercial team with the knowledge, skills and behaviors to win in their territory, and certify them to Smith & Nephew standards. This position reports to the Senior Director, Commercial Training and Education Emerging Markets in the respective franchise, cluster, region, or local market. What will you be doing?
- The Commercial Training Manager will deliver training to both new and tenured sales professionals, through various venues including live instructor led courses, virtual classrooms, and field-based training / coaching.
- Ensure that the commercial teams are certified on the knowledge, skills, and behaviors needed to win (e.g., product, clinical and procedural knowledge, primary competitors' knowledge, sales enablement skills, & business planning).
- The Commercial Training Manager will deliver the curriculum as aligned with the Global Commercial Training competency framework.
- Manage learning events (classroom, webinar, field based, etc.) & own the Learning platform activities.
- Collaborate with HR and commercial leaders to remediate gaps in performance.
- Act as a mentor and role model for sales reps and encourage a culture of continuous learning and development.
- Collaborate with Global curriculum leads, Global Marketing, and local business leaders (Commercial Leadership / BUDs / Cluster VPs etc.) on content creation, aligned to competency model.
- Tailor globally developed content to meet the needs of the local market.
- Act as project lead for the Field sales training program in the respective cluster through monitoring the activities of the Field Sales Trainers on a consistent basis to ensure the accomplishment of the project outcomes.
